    Default depth finder

    had my boat out this weekend for some perch and depth finder kept saying low voltage
    anyone know what would cause this

    Bad connections, bad battery, wiring subtandard in size(too much voltage drop), too much load on the electrical system,take your pick.
    Was this while the motor is running ?
